    Help Me with BOOTS please

    Don't buy a boot based strictly on what you ski. Find one THAT FITS YOUR FOOT. If you can find a couple that do, then flex them and decide which one you like better. It's retarded here how people just buy the SPK or Foil boots because they are "park" boots, and that means that because they...
